标题:比特币钱包地址的类型及其应用场景
文章:
随着区块链技术的不断发展,比特币作为一种去中心化的数字货币,已经深入人心。比特币钱包是用户管理比特币资产的工具,而钱包地址则是比特币交易的关键组成部分。本文将介绍比特币钱包地址的类型及其应用场景,并引用权威数据来源进行说明。
一、比特币钱包地址的类型
1. 公钥地址(Public Key Address)
公钥地址是比特币钱包地址的一种类型,由用户公钥经过编码处理得到。公钥地址可以用于接收比特币,但用户需要保护好自己的私钥,否则他人可以轻易地将比特币从该地址转移走。
2. 私钥地址(Private Key Address)
私钥地址是比特币钱包地址的另一种类型,由用户私钥经过编码处理得到。私钥是用户唯一识别符,用于发起比特币交易。私钥必须保密,一旦泄露,用户资产将面临风险。
3. 扩展地址(Extended Public Key,简称xPub)
扩展地址是一种新的钱包地址格式,由主公钥和一系列子公钥组成。扩展地址可以方便地生成多个子地址,适用于多签名钱包和多账户管理。
二、比特币钱包地址的应用场景
1. 交易接收
用户可以通过公钥地址接收比特币,这是比特币交易中最常见的应用场景。例如,商家在网站或应用中公布公钥地址,方便用户进行支付。
2. 资产管理
用户可以使用比特币钱包地址管理自己的比特币资产,包括查看余额、转账记录等。
3. 数字身份验证
比特币钱包地址可以作为用户在区块链上的数字身份,用于身份验证、数字签名等场景。
4. 智能合约
在智能合约中,比特币钱包地址用于接收和支付代币。例如,以太坊上的ERC20代币交易,就需要使用比特币钱包地址。
5. 跨链支付
比特币钱包地址可以用于跨链支付,例如将比特币转移到其他区块链上的代币。
三、权威数据来源
根据比特币官方数据,截至2023,全球比特币地址数量已超过一亿个。其中,公钥地址和私钥地址是两种最常见的类型。
总结
比特币钱包地址的类型多样,各有应用场景。用户在选择和使用比特币钱包地址时,需根据自身需求进行合理选择,并确保私钥安全,以保障资产安全。
以下是与标题相关的常见问答知识清单及其详细解答:
1. 问题:什么是比特币钱包地址?
解答:比特币钱包地址是用户在比特币网络上的唯一标识,用于接收和发送比特币。
2. 问题:比特币钱包地址是如何生成的?
解答:比特币钱包地址通过用户的公钥或私钥生成,经过一定的编码处理得到。
3. 问题:公钥地址和私钥地址有什么区别?
解答:公钥地址是公开的,用于接收比特币;私钥地址是私密的,用于发起比特币交易。
4. 问题:如何保护比特币钱包地址?
解答:保护比特币钱包地址主要是保护私钥安全,避免泄露给他人。
5. 问题:扩展地址有哪些优点?
解答:扩展地址可以方便地生成多个子地址,适用于多签名钱包和多账户管理。
6. 问题:比特币钱包地址可以用于哪些场景?
解答:比特币钱包地址可以用于交易接收、资产管理、数字身份验证、智能合约和跨链支付等场景。
7. 问题:为什么说比特币钱包地址是用户在区块链上的唯一标识?
解答:因为每个比特币钱包地址都对应唯一的公钥或私钥,而公钥或私钥是用户在区块链上的唯一身份证明。
8. 问题:如何检查比特币钱包地址的有效性?
解答:可以通过比特币区块链浏览器或钱包软件检查比特币钱包地址的有效性。
9. 问题:比特币钱包地址是否可以重用?
解答:比特币钱包地址可以重用,但建议为不同目的创建不同的地址,以保障资产安全。
10. 问题:如何避免比特币钱包地址泄露?
解答:保护私钥安全是避免比特币钱包地址泄露的关键,可以使用密码管理器、硬件钱包等工具来保护私钥。